About

Wolfenstein: The New Order is a 2014 first-person action shooter that rebooted the classic franchise with a fresh take on fast-paced combat gameplay. Dropping the supernatural elements of its predecessor, the game focuses on intense firefights and level-based progression as you battle through enemy encounters. With a solid 82/100 rating, it delivers a satisfying action experience that remains engaging for FPS enthusiasts.

The game is quite accessible from a PC performance standpoint, requiring only an entry-level GPU to achieve playable framerates. You'll need at least 4 GB of RAM and a GPU with a benchmark score around 1936 or higher to run it smoothly. Even modest graphics cards can deliver solid FPS at 1080p, making it an excellent title for benchmarking older or budget hardware without demanding high-end components.

If you enjoy straightforward action shooters with solid gunplay mechanics, Wolfenstein: The New Order is worth your time. Its combination of accessible performance requirements and engaging gameplay makes it a smart choice for both testing PC builds and enjoying classic first-person action.

Storyline

Three years after the destruction of the Black Sun portal, the Nazis have deployed advanced technologies enabling them to turn the tide against the Allies. B.J. Blazkowicz is chasing down his arch-enemy General Wilhelm "Deathshead" Strasse, knowing that if he can kill Deathshead, the Nazi war machine will be crippled. His plans backfire however and Blazkowicz is mortally wounded and put into a partial coma. After being rescued by a Polish fishing vessel and taken to an asylum in Poland where 14 years pass, he is emerging into this world of darkness, dominated by the Nazis. Blazkowicz arms up once again and sets out to reignite the flames of rebellion and toppling the Nazi regime.
